Transaction d543793c908838def7ae21ccb878f93c2ce11832cb7c6cdd914938499d71d11a

2 Input
2 Outputs
  • d543793c908838def7ae21ccb878f93c2ce11832cb7c6cdd914938499d71d11a:0
  • value  46365709
    address  3AMpBue5GoRHEsnswRfwtcYa5mpqUHFsoG
  • d543793c908838def7ae21ccb878f93c2ce11832cb7c6cdd914938499d71d11a:1
  • value  100000000
    address  365E6ycGPLGeUBSDdzss3rpgtNrbXojcyY